第一课第三周7-10节-ai算法这么棒,为什么我们周围的医院没有使用这些系统?

Tina姐 Tina姐     2022-12-15     486

关键词:

既然您已经了解了医学成像的分类和分割模型,并且您已经在前面构建了您的胸部x射线分类模型,那么您可能会想知道为什么我们周围的医院或诊所没有使用这些系统。

在本课中,您将了解一些挑战和机会,使这些系统成为常规医疗实践的一部分。

泛化能力

在临床应用人工智能算法的主要挑战之一是实现可靠的泛化。由于各种各样的原因,归纳起来很困难。

让我们看一个例子。假设我们根据美国的数据开发了胸部x光模型,我们想把它应用到另一个国家的医院,比如印度。

在印度,病人可能会有x光片,看起来与模型所训练的不一样。举一个非常具体的例子,结核病在印度相当普遍,但在我们在美国训练模式的医院中不太可能如此普遍。

在将该模型应用于印度之前,我们需要测试该模型检测结核病或结核病的能力。

让我们看另一个例子,这次是我们的脑肿瘤分割模型。我们已经能够根据几年来从几个国家收集的数据来衡量模型的性能,但是核磁共振成像技术在全球和时间上都不是标准的。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-Zies1NOM-1627814680149)(https://files.mdnice.com/user/15745/45004a30-e66a-4b81-b92d-464717a4b592.png)]
最新的扫描仪比旧的扫描仪有更高的分辨率。在我们将分割模型应用于一家新医院之前,我们需要确保该模型能够推广到医院扫描仪的分辨率。

额外的验证集

为了能够度量一个模型在一个没有见过的总体上的泛化,我们希望能够从新的总体中对一个测试集进行评估。这称为外部验证

当测试集从与模型训练集相同的分布中提取时,外部验证可以与内部验证进行对比。

如果我们发现我们没有推广到新的人群中,那么我们可以从新人群中获得更多的样本来创建一个小的训练和验证集,然后根据这些新数据对模型进行微调。

我们讨论过的所有这些研究都使用回顾性数据,这意味着他们使用历史标记的数据来训练和测试算法。

然而,要了解人工智能模型在现实世界中的效用,就需要将其应用于现实世界数据或预期数据。

对于一个胸部x光模型,这可能意味着我们应用一个经过训练的模型来解释新病人接受的胸部x光片。

为什么模型的结果在前瞻性数据上看起来会不同?其中一个原因是,对于回顾性数据,通常需要采取一些步骤来处理和清理数据,但在现实世界中,模型必须处理原始数据。

作为一个具体的例子,你训练模型的数据集已经过滤,只包括正面的x光片,x光片是从病人的正面或背面拍摄的。

然而,在现实世界中,从患者侧面拍摄x光片的一小部分也是很常见的。这些被称为横向x射线。

在我们的模型能够应用于现实世界之前,我们要么需要过滤掉这样的胸部x光片,要么调整模型使其工作。

模型对真实患者的影响

另一个需要反映实际应用的人工智能模型的挑战。我们已经看到了一些评估我们构建的模型的方法,包括查看AUROC曲线下的区域或查看dice得分。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-aOn5w6h3-1627814680153)(https://files.mdnice.com/user/15745/afcb795d-7be7-4093-89fb-867fe387bb14.png)]
然而,在现实世界中,我们希望能够看到我们的模型对真实患者的影响。具体来说,我们关心的是衡量模型是否最终改善了患者的健康结果。

解决这一挑战的一种方法包括决策曲线分析,它可以帮助量化使用模型指导患者护理的净效益。

另一种方法是观察在随机对照试验中发生了什么,我们比较了使用人工智能算法的患者和未应用人工智能算法的患者的结果。我们将在课程三中了解随机对照试验的设置。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-cyF7B9Qr-1627814680154)(https://files.mdnice.com/user/15745/311b745d-34e7-40ef-9312-4ca5be008e3e.png)]
在现实世界中,我们不仅要分析模型的总体效果,而且要分析它对人口亚群的影响。这将包括不同年龄、性别和社会经济地位的患者。

这使我们能够找到关键的算法盲点或意外偏差。例如,皮肤癌分类可以达到与皮肤科医生相媲美的表现水平,当用于浅肤色患者时,先前在深色肤色的图像上表现不佳。

算法偏差是一个重要而开放的研究领域。在关于医学预后的第二课中,我们将介绍一个场景,在这个场景中,像误用缺失数据这样简单的事情会导致偏差模型。

最后,在现实世界中应用人工智能医学模型的主要挑战和机遇之一是更好地理解这些算法将如何与临床医生的决策交互
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-U3vTG0A5-1627814680155)(https://files.mdnice.com/user/15745/73331248-054a-4d34-b8f0-1acc2810f8ab.png)]
人工智能模型的一个局限性,即使是我们在本课程中看到的模型,也很难理解模型的内部工作原理,从而理解它们如何以及为什么做出某种决定。

在课程3中,我们将了解如何解释我们建立的胸部x光模型,以及了解这些算法的临床决策过程的几种不同方法。

祝贺您完成本周建立医学图像分割模型。您已经了解了MRI数据、深度学习体系结构和分割损失函数,以及评估方法。

在本周的作业中,你将看到所有这些想法是如何建立和评估你自己的脑肿瘤分割模型的。

最后,您现在也意识到了将这些模型作为临床护理的一部分所带来的一些挑战和机遇。

文章持续更新,可以关注微信公众号【医学图像人工智能实战营】获取最新动态,一个关注于医学图像处理领域前沿科技的公众号。坚持已实践为主,手把手带你做项目,打比赛,写论文。凡原创文章皆提供理论讲解,实验代码,实验数据。只有实践才能成长的更快,关注我们,一起学习进步~

我是Tina, 我们下篇博客见~

白天工作晚上写文,呕心沥血

觉得写的不错的话最后,求点赞,评论,收藏。或者一键三连

第一课第三周3-4节--2d和3d分割的优缺点以及如何构建unet模型(代码片段)

...称为体素。让我们讨论两种利用MRI数据进行分割的方法。第一种是二维方法在2D方法中,我们将构建的3DMR 查看详情

第一课第三周1-2节-了解医学图像分割以及探索mri数据格式以及作业解读(代码片段)

本周将学习图像分割,图像分割在许多医学影像应用中起着至关重要的作用,例如组织大小的量化、疾病的定位和治疗计划。我们将重温您在过去两周学到的一些相同的想法,看看它们是如何扩展到图像分割的。在本... 查看详情

第一课第三周大作业--mri脑肿瘤自动分割教程(代码片段)

...型5.1训练6评估作业文件吴恩达-医学图像AI专项课程-作业/第一课/第一 查看详情

吴恩达-第一课第二周8-10节-什么是置信区间,有什么作用

在这节课中,我们将了解评估医学模型的另一个非常重要的方面,即报告我们的评估中的可变性。我们将研究如何使用置信区间来显示这种可变性。假设一家医院有5万名病人,我们想知道我们的胸部x光模型对每个人...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周11节总结(代码片段)

回顾一下医学图像深度学习面临的三个挑战三个挑战我们将讨论医学图像训练算法的三个关键挑战:类不平衡挑战、多任务挑战和数据集大小挑战。对于每一个挑战,我们将介绍一到两种应对方法。类别不平衡:可以...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周13-15节-迁移学习+数据增强

回顾一下医学图像深度学习面临的三个挑战三个挑战我们将讨论医学图像训练算法的三个关键挑战:类不平衡挑战、多任务挑战和数据集大小挑战。对于每一个挑战,我们将介绍一到两种应对方法。类别不平衡:可以...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周19-20节(代码片段)

...们回顾一下上一节提出的医学图像创建数据集的三个挑战第一个挑战涉及到我们如何使这些测试集独立第二个挑战涉及我们如何对它们进行采样第三个挑战涉及我们如何设置groundtruth让我们来讨论第二个挑战:集合抽样。sampl...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周6-10节总结+作业解读(代码片段)

...学习在医学图像分类问题上的一些前沿应用。本文将介绍第一课第一周6-10节的内容。主要讲解构建一个分类模型去识别胸片的肿块。以及分类模型将面临的三个挑战:类不平衡挑战、多任务挑战和数据集大小挑战。本节重点...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周4-5节总结(代码片段)

4-5节主要是例举了三个深度学习医学诊断案例。本周,我们将直接进入建立一个深度学习模型的任务胸部x光分类。通过这个例子,您将学到的许多想法在许多医学成像测试中都有广泛的应用。本周,我们将从三个医... 查看详情

吴恩达-第一课第二周1-7节总结-医学深度学习模型的评估汇总(代码片段)

医学深度学习模型的评估汇总本周我们将深入探讨医学深度学习模型的评估。在医学上,由于决策具有很高的影响力,我们关心的是准确地了解模型何时对患者起作用,什么时候不起作用。您将学习一下指标,包...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周1-3节总结(代码片段)

点此了解课程吴恩达新课医学图像AI(AIforMedicine)专项课程推荐欢迎来到医学人工智能专业。如果你已经完成了深度学习专业化或机器学习课程,并且你正在寻找更深入掌握人工智能的应用领域,这是一个很好的... 查看详情

吴恩达实验(神经网络和深度学习)第一课第三周,代码和数据集,亲测可运行

代码和数据集已上传到文件中应该可以直接下载吧(第一次上传文件,感觉是),解压后把文件夹拷贝到jupyter工作空间即可注:我对下载的代码的格式稍作了修改,原来定义函数与调用函数在两个单元格里,我直接运行他总给...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周16-18节-如何确保数据集病人不重叠+作业解说(代码片段)

模型测试既然你已经了解了如何训练医学诊断模型,那么让我们来谈谈如何测试这样的模型。接下来你会学习如何测试这样的一个模型。您将学习如何正确使用训练、验证和测试集。以及为了评估你的模型需要强大的groundtrut... 查看详情

第二课第一周大作业--构建和评估一个线性风险模型(代码片段)

之前教程:第二课第一周第1节-AI用于医学预后简介第二课第一周第2节-做医学预后,你需要掌握什么?第二课第一周第3-4节-什么是预后?第二课第一周第4-7节医学预后案例欣赏+作业解析第二课第一周第8节风险得分... 查看详情

第二课第一周大作业--构建和评估一个线性风险模型(代码片段)

之前教程:第二课第一周第1节-AI用于医学预后简介第二课第一周第2节-做医学预后,你需要掌握什么?第二课第一周第3-4节-什么是预后?第二课第一周第4-7节医学预后案例欣赏+作业解析第二课第一周第8节风险得分... 查看详情

吴恩达-医学图像人工智能专项课程-第一课第一周1-3节(代码片段)

欢迎来到医学人工智能专业。如果你已经完成了深度学习专业化或机器学习课程,并且你正在寻找更深入掌握人工智能的应用领域,这是一个很好的专业化学习。要想成为真正优秀的机器学习,最重要的事情之一就是... 查看详情

第二课第一周大作业--构建和评估一个线性风险模型(代码片段)

之前教程:第二课第一周第1节-AI用于医学预后简介第二课第一周第2节-做医学预后,你需要掌握什么?第二课第一周第3-4节-什么是预后?第二课第一周第4-7节医学预后案例欣赏+作业解析第二课第一周第8节风险得分... 查看详情

收藏第一课第二周作业-学会计算分类各种指标-超详细教程(代码片段)

本次作业文件:在第一课/第一课大作业/week2metric这节课不需要对模型进行预测,所有的预测结果已经在csv文件中给出。作为提醒,我们的数据集包含14种不同情况的X射线,可通过X射线诊断。我们将使用我们在这... 查看详情